How much do the cashier j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 8, 2026, the average hourly pay for the cashier in the United States is $13.46,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$11.30 and $15.38 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between The Cashier vs Retail Sales Associate?

AspectThe CashierRetail Sales Associate
Primary RoleProcessing transactions at checkoutAssisting customers with product selection and sales
Required SkillsCustomer service, basic math, POS operationCustomer service, product knowledge, sales skills
Work EnvironmentCheckout counters, retail storesSales floors, customer interaction areas
CertificationsNone typically requiredNone typically required

The Cashier primarily handles transaction processing at checkout counters, focusing on customer payments and basic customer service. Retail Sales Associates engage in assisting customers with product selection, providing sales support, and enhancing the shopping experience. While both roles require strong customer service skills and work in retail environments, the Retail Sales Associate has a broader scope involving active sales and product knowledge, whereas the Cashier's main responsibility is transaction management.

What are some common challenges cashiers face during busy periods, and how can they effectively manage them?

During peak hours, cashiers often encounter long lines, increased pressure to work quickly, and the need to maintain accuracy when handling transactions. Effective time management, clear communication with customers, and staying calm under pressure are essential for managing these challenges. Many employers provide training on how to handle high-traffic situations, and teamwork is important—cashiers often coordinate with supervisors and other staff to ensure smooth operations and customer satisfaction.

What is a cashier?

Cashiers are employees responsible for handling transactions at retail stores, supermarkets, restaurants, and other businesses. Their main duties include scanning items, processing payments, giving change, issuing receipts, and sometimes assisting with bagging purchases. They also answer customer questions, resolve minor complaints, and may help restock shelves or maintain a tidy checkout area. Cashiers are an essential part of the customer service experience and play a key role in ensuring smooth and efficient sales operations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a cashier,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Cashier, you need strong numeracy skills, attention to detail,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, cash handling procedures, and basic accounting software is common in this role. Excellent customer service, communication, and problem-solving abilities help cashiers create positive experiences and efficiently resolve issues. These skills ensure accurate transactions, prevent errors, and foster customer satisfaction in a fast-paced retail environment.

Job description

Title:Cashier/Stock

Reports To:General Manager/Manager/Shift Supervisor

Department:Cafe Operations

FLSA Status:Non-exempt Hourly

The Cashier/Stock position at Au Bon Pain is the first and last impression for our guests. Located towards the front of every cafe, the cashier is the person responsible for speaking with every guest on both their way in and out of the cafe, directing traffic, and collecting payment for all purchases.The cashier is also responsible for helping to keep the cafe stocked with all products.

Position Summary:

The Cashier Position will be responsible for the providing excellent customer service for our guests while ensuring aCLEAN, FASTandFRIENDLYcafe environment. A Cashier is trained to assist with any guest's expectations. If you enjoy making people smile while working with a great team and being part of a Company that is a great place to work, we want you as a Cashier!

Cashier Job Responsibilities:

  • Responsible for completing ABP transactions by scanning items, inputting product codes, taking in cash and providing change or processing card transactions.
  • Responsible for cash drawer security, cash balance and adhering to all other aspects in ABP's cash handling policy.
  • Provide "guest-first" service by listening, responding and resolving all guests' requests quickly through strong knowledge of all cafe products.
  • Stock bakery, ref-con products, and impulse items.
  • Be professional in all interactions with guests and team members.
  • Work together as a team to achieve efficient operations.
  • Keep work area clean, organized and stocked.
  • Resolve any problems and keep management informed about issues and problems as they arise.
  • Clean and maintain dining room as needed.
  • Assist with bringing out coffee as needed.
  • Other related responsibilities as assigned.

Cashier Job Requirements:

  • Must be 18 years or older
  • Strong attention to detail and time management
  • Passion for quality, safety and sanitation
  • Excellent communication and listening skills, can read, write, and speak English
  • Friendly attitude and team playerwho will contribute to the culture and standards of Au Bon Pain
  • Decision maker with ability to work independently
  • Urgent, proactive demeanor
  • Ability to maintain a standing position for extended periods of time (up to 6 hours at a time).
  • Ability to move around the cafe to attend to the needs of guests
  • Ability to move, lift and handle equipment, supplies and other objects weighing up to 25 pounds.
  • Ability to position self to move items weighing up to 25 pounds from floor to shelves and cabinets above and below counter height
